About

Open GitHub repositories directly in Visual Studio Code with a single click. This extension adds a sleek, blue VS Code button to GitHub's repository interface.

FEATURES:

• Elegant integration: Adds a blue VS Code button to GitHub's tab navigation (alongside HTTPS/SSH/GitHub CLI)
• One-click workflow: Clone and open repositories in VS Code without manual copying of URLs
• Visual design: Official VS Code icon with a distinctive blue wireframe border
• Seamless experience: Works with GitHub's modern UI across different repository pages

USAGE:

Navigate to any GitHub repository
Look for the VS Code button in the tab navigation area (next to HTTPS/SSH/GitHub CLI)
Click the VS Code button to clone and open the repository in VS Code
HOW IT WORKS:
This extension uses the vscode:// URL protocol to communicate with Visual Studio Code. When you click the VS Code button, it instructs VS Code to clone the current repository and open it in a new window.

REQUIREMENTS:
• Google Chrome browser (or any Chromium-based browser like Edge, Brave, etc.)
• Visual Studio Code installed on your system
• VS Code must be configured to handle the vscode:// protocol (this is typically set up by default during installation)
